Today marks the 94th birth anniversary of Kannada superstar Dr. Rajkumar. He was considered one of the most talented and popular actors in the Kannada film industry. Born in a poor family he went ahead and became one of the greatest of all time. Rajkumar is a cultural icon also he holds a status that goes beyond being an idol in the Kannada Film Industry.

Dr. Rajkumar was born on April 24th, 1929 in Gajanur village in Tamil Nadu as Singanalluru Puttaswamayya Muthuraju.

He appeared in the 1942 film ‘Bhakta Prahlada’ as a child artist and had a very small role. He also acted in the 1952 film ‘Sri Srinivasa Kalyana’ as a sage Agasthya. His role was so insignificant in the film that he couldn’t recognize himself before it passed.

One time he was kidnapped by the dreaded criminal Veerappan and was held hostage for 109 days before being released.

Dr. Rajkumar has received eleven Karnataka State Film Awards, ten South Filmfare Awards, and one National Film Award. He also received the NTR National Award in 2002. He was awarded with an honorary doctorate from the University of Mysore and is also a recipient of the Padma Bhushan. He also received the Dadasaheb Phalke Award in 1995 for his lifetime contribution to Indian Cinema.
